The Greystones were designed by George H. Wells in 1916, making them the first of Jackson Heights' desirable garden complexes. Flanking 80th Street, the Tudor-inspired gray brick buildings and front landscaping create a gorgeous streetscape while the interior gardens stretch the entire block. Residents of the pet-friendly walk-up co-op enjoy part-time superintendent service, basement laundry, free storage, a bike room and the privacy of just two apartments per floor. Jackson Heights is a landmarked planned community originally built in the early 1900s, featuring prewar garden cooperatives with interior courtyards that are listed on the National Register of Historic Places. Approximately 80% of the housing stock consists of co-ops, with the remainder split among attached single-family homes, multi-family row houses, and detached residences, all served by the 7, E, F, M, and R trains at the Roosevelt Avenue hub. Travers Park provides green space, and the commercial corridors along Roosevelt Avenue and 37th Avenue anchor the neighborhood's retail activity.
